Bulk Copolymerization of Styrene and Methyl Methacrylate at Elevated Temperatures

, , &
Pages 871-878 | Received 01 Feb 2006, Accepted 01 Feb 2006, Published online: 07 Feb 2007
 

Abstract

Reactivity ratios and full conversion range data (conversion, copolymer composition, molecular weight averages, glass transition temperature) are presented for styrene (STY)/methyl methacrylate (MMA)/copolymerization at elevated temperatures (130 and 150°C), a region where polymerization studies are scarce for the system, both for purely thermal polymerization and for peroxide‐initiated ones.
